FAQ: How do I access the first-aid room?

The first-aid room at Corvane Place is on the ground floor, beside the east stairwell. It is kept locked to protect the supplies, but access must never be delayed in an emergency. Alert reception if you use anything so stock can be replaced. The door keypad accepts the code shown below.

staff pass of kawip-hawef = bdg-QLP-2

Subject: Pricing Review — Meridia Line

Dear Executive Team,

Following our review of the Meridia product line, we recommend a modest 4% adjustment to list prices, phased over two quarters to limit churn among long-standing accounts in the Halverton region. Margin modeling by Priya Andel's team supports this cautiously. Full assumptions are attached for board discussion next week. Please find the confidential note on our forward plans below.

internal memo for hahaf-kahof: Only 39 of the 428 pilot accounts renewed Sorion, so a churn review is set for April 12. Praokix Freight is in early talks to buy Queniusox Group for about $145.8 million.

Design excerpt — Quillbeam crash pipeline. Crash reports from the Pondera mobile app batch on-device, then upload over Wi-Fi only unless severity is fatal. Server-side, we dedupe by stack fingerprint before symbolication to keep queue depth sane during bad releases. Release managers gating a rollout should watch ingestion lag against these thresholds:

tuning table, faduf-baduf:
PRIORITIES = {
    "ulavan": 191,
    "silys": 750,
    "goriel": 238,
    "kelmir": 66,
    "wendor": 432,
}

Release checklist — LiftSim weekly sync. Verify dispatch-queue replay passes on the ten-car Harrowgate tower scenario. Confirm idle-car parking heuristic no longer oscillates between lobby and floor 14. Smoke-test the morning up-peak profile at 2x speed. Doc updates for the new hall-call batching flag are merged. Perf delta vs. last cut is under 3%. Sign-off from Priya before tagging. The candidate build to validate is listed below.

session token of kafop-hawep = htk21_413e49a27bdeacde54774